SU 17 SE OGBOURNE ST ANDREW VILLAGE CENTRE 7/64 Pair of Large monuments in churchyard, 9m south of chancel, Church of St. Andrew II Two chest tombs, mid C19. Moulded table and base, recessed corner balusters. From north: (a) William Stratton Large, died 1824 and wife Elizabeth, died 1839, and 2 children; (b) Robert Large, died 1789, and wife Sarah, died 1792, and daughter. His is a good inscription.
